In the recent years, the research of hiding information has become a hot issue. The purpose of hiding information is to hide the fact that the information exists. As it means that the attacker doesn't know where the information exists. Superiority of hiding information to the traditional encryption technology is that the hiding information is able not to attract the attacker's notice, thereby reducing the probability of attack. Hiding information is mainly used in stealth communication, so it emphasized on hiding capacity and high transparency. In recent years, a large number of hiding information algorithms appear, although these algorithms incline to ripe and meanwhile there exists different degree of weakness. This thesis researches on the hiding information which held the image as the carrier and based on empirical mode decomposition algorithm. The basic of empirical mode decomposition algorithm which this thesis offers has the large hiding capacity and high transparency and it fully reflects the characteristics of hiding information. There are the specific processes: firstly to use the empirical mode decomposition algorithm to make a piece of index image separate; then to embed hidden information (encryption processing of hidden information) into the recombined image after separating; and then to extract original information from the carrier image which includes hidden information and to use the NCC and the PSNR algorithm to make objective evaluation; finally to attack the image which contains hidden information. The experimental result shows that this algorithm has better robustness and transparency than others. Through a large number of experiments, the algorithm which this thesis offers has more remarkably improved in the aspect of hiding capacity than the same algorithm.
